FAQs

How do I customize the Glyph Interface?

You can customize the Glyph Interface through the 'Glyph Interface' section in your phone's Settings menu. Here you can assign unique light patterns and sounds to different notifications and contacts.

What is Essential Space AI?

Essential Space AI is a suite of AI tools integrated into Nothing OS designed to help organize your notes, ideas, and content in one place, streamlining your workflow without needing to switch between multiple applications.

Can I use the phone in direct sunlight?

Yes, the display features up to 4500-nit HDR and 1600-nit HBM brightness, ensuring clear visibility even in bright sunlight.

What software updates can I expect?

The Nothing Phone (4a) comes with Nothing OS 4.1 based on Android 16 and is promised 3 years of Android version updates and 6 years of security patches.

Does the phone come with a charger?

Yes, a charger is included with the Nothing Phone (4a).

What does the IP64 rating mean?

The IP64 rating indicates that the phone is protected against dust ingress and water splashes from any direction. It does not mean the phone is waterproof.

How do I enable facial recognition?

You can set up facial recognition during the initial phone setup or later via the 'Security' or 'Biometrics' section in the Settings menu.

Troubleshooting

Phone is unresponsive

Perform a force restart by pressing and holding the power button for about 10-15 seconds until the device reboots. If the issue persists, ensure the battery is charged.

Glyph Interface not working

Check the Glyph settings in the phone's menu to ensure it's enabled and configured correctly. Restart the device to see if the issue resolves.

Poor Wi-Fi or Bluetooth connection

Toggle Wi-Fi/Bluetooth off and on. Restart the phone. If issues continue, try resetting network settings (this will remove saved Wi-Fi passwords).

Apps crashing or performing slowly

Close background apps. Clear the cache for the specific app. Ensure the phone's software and apps are updated. If a specific app is problematic, try uninstalling and reinstalling it.

Battery draining quickly

Check battery usage in settings to identify power-hungry apps. Reduce screen brightness or set the adaptive refresh rate to a lower maximum. Limit background activity for non-essential apps.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

Initial Setup: Upon first powering on your Nothing Phone (4a), you'll be guided through a straightforward setup process. This includes selecting your language, connecting to Wi-Fi, signing into your Google account, and configuring security options like fingerprint unlocking and facial recognition. You can also choose to transfer data from a previous device.

Compatibility: The Phone (4a) operates on Android 16 with Nothing OS, ensuring broad compatibility with the vast ecosystem of Android applications available on the Google Play Store. It supports nano-SIM cards and is unlocked for use with various mobile carriers.

Care Instructions: To maintain the phone's appearance and functionality:

  • Cleaning: Use a soft, slightly damp, lint-free cloth to clean the screen and body. Avoid abrasive materials or harsh chemicals.
  • Display: The screen is protected by glass, but using a screen protector is recommended to prevent scratches.
  • Durability: While the Phone (4a) has an IP64 rating for dust and splash resistance, avoid submerging it in water or exposing it to high-pressure water jets.
  • Charging: Use the included charger or a compatible USB PD charger for optimal charging speeds. Avoid exposing the charging port to debris.
  • Temperature: Operate the device within normal temperature ranges and avoid prolonged exposure to extreme heat or cold.
